DTA fast Racing Dash2 Setup

The Racing Dash2 digital dashboard display can obtain data from a DTAfast S-series ECU easily through CAN bus or serial port. 

Hardware Connectivity

The connection between DTA and Racing Dash2 is through CAN bus which essentially means you need to connect two wires: CANH and CANL. They are available here on a DTA S40 and S40Pro ECUs:

OR CAN bus wires on S60, S80, S100:

CAN High and CAN Low wires must be connected to the corresponding CANH and CANL wires on the Racing DASH2 preferably using a twisted pair cable.

CAN bus configuration in DTASwin

Connect to the DTA ecu and enable CAN stream from “Other map settings” – Data Stream:

Software configuration on Racing DASH2

Connect the Racing Dash2 to a windows laptop using a USB to Serial adapter cable (not supplied)

Run the Configuration Software available from here.

Drag and drop parameters from the right “Data from ECU” to any position on the dash.

Press Save to keep settings.

Additional information

If there is no CAN bus termination resistor inside the DTA it has to be added externally. Just connect a 120 ohm resistor between CANH and CANL wires somewhere close to the ECU.

In case CAN bus link is not possible DTA ECUs can be connected using the serial port. Adapter cable is included if requested by the customer. In that case disable the CAN stream from DTASwin and enable DASH RS232 Stream. Make sure all other values are set to 0.
